Tom Hanks upcoming World War II drama ‘Greyhound’ is going to premiere on Apple TV plus. Sony Pictures’ is producing the film, directed by Aaron Schneider.

The film was supposed to release on June 12 but due to the Coronavirus pandemic, it has been delayed. Now, Apple will release it digitally at a later date.

Apple acquired its distribution rights at USD 70 million.

The film, based on the 1955 novel ‘The Good Shepherd’ by CS Forester has its screenplay written by lead actor, Tom Hanks. It also features Stephen Graham, Rob Morgan and Elisabeth Shue in prominent roles.

Set in the early days of World War II, it is a story about a U.S. Navy commander’s first war time assignment in command of a multi-national escort group defending a merchant ship convoy under attack by submarines in early 1942. Hank plays the role of Commander Ernest Krause.
